Boronia clavata HEATHER WAND, BREMER BORONIA Rutaceae : Plant type: evergreen shrub Hardiness zones: 9-10 Sunlight: warm low sun to dappled light Soil Moisture: dry between watering to constantly moist Soil: ordinary soil, enriched soil, mildly acidic to mildly alkaline The deep and lingering spicy, citrusy perfume comes from the oils in the plant’s leaves, flowers and fruits. Erica carnea, the winter heath, winter-flowering heather, spring heath or alpine heath, is a species of flowering plant in the family Ericaceae, native to mountainous areas of central, eastern and southern Europe, where it grows in coniferous woodlands or stony slopes.
